Which response by the nurse is best? the rehabilitation staff can evaluate your progress. Which goal is the priority for a client with a fractured femur who ...Have client advance the right leg. Explanation: First, perform hand hygiene. Next, secure a gait belt around client's waist. Then, place the cane in the client's right hand, because the right side is the unaffected side. Have the client advance the cane and the left leg about 4 to 8 inches (10 to 20 cm).A nurse is assessing a client who has a fractured left femur and is in skeletal traction. The nurse should identify which of the following goals for the client's therapy?, A nurse is an emergency department is caring for an 18-month-old toddler who has a fractured left femur.Discuss the complications that the client's may experience if they don't cooperate with the care plan. The nurse should discuss the care plan and its rationale with the client. Calling the physician to report the client's noncompliance won't alter the client's degree of participation and shouldn't be used to force the client to comply.
